Stormy Seas is a game where you position the ships and the levers in the same position as the gamecard shows you then by sliding levers and moving the ships you maneuver the little "red" boat which is YOU through to safe passage and out!! Soooo much fun and a great learning tool as well.

Rush Hour is very similiar to Stormy Seas, but you use different size cars instead of boats/ships and there are no lever to move....just slide the cars and turn them.

Answers for both games are on the back of the card....but no cheating!! Both games also have slots on the gameboard to hold the gamecard so you can easily set up the game to play.
